Two-day event at county fairgrounds includes vendors, Santa visit
The annual Cotulla Country Christmas will be held at the La Salle County Fairgrounds on Saturday and Sunday, December 9 and 10, offering gifts, décor, toys and food to start the holiday season.
The event features vendor booths, children’s activities, a visit from Santa Claus, entertainment and other festivities for all ages both indoors and outdoors, and makes a favorite shopping destination for unique gifts.
Arts and crafts, jewelry, clothing and accessories, leather goods, wood- and metalwork, holiday trimmings, toys and games, custom-made trinkets and housewares are among the specialty items on sale in the exhibition barn and adjoining pavilion.
Gates are open 10 a.m. to 6 p.m. Saturday and noon to 6 p.m. Sunday.
